World Whisky Day is almost upon us! Returning as always for the third Saturday in May – that’s May 20th this time around – we’re already making our own plans for this year’s celebration and if you enjoy a good time we strongly suggest you do the same. Essentially an excuse to get together with some great company and bask in the glory of your favourite whisky, World Whisky Day is an event that’s open to everyone, from the most experienced aficionado to those dipping their toes in the world of this delightful spirit for the very first time In that case, check out our comprehensive whisky guide). Just you, your family and friends, and the water of life. What could be better?

Death & Taxes, Brisbane, Qld
Located in Brisbane’s oldest laneway – Burnett Lane – Death & Taxes is one of the most intimate and elegant bars in which to enjoy a dram or two. With a grand back bar displaying over 1,000 spirit bottles, a selection of luxurious booths, and a wonderful 100-year-old wooden floor, it’s a hard spot to beat for atmosphere and beverage range.
Taking World Whisky Day and kicking it up a notch or two, Death & Taxes will be running a whisky and chocolate flights menu for the entire month of May. This menu will pair both Benriach and GlenDronach expressions with a range of delicious treats from local chocolatier, Basik, boasting bespoke flavours designed to pair perfectly with the very finest whiskies.
Earl’s Juke Joint, Sydney, NSW
Located in the heart of Sydney’s vibrant Newtown hub, Earl’s Juke Joint brings a touch of New Orleans to the Harbour City. The venue offers a wide range of delicious cocktails, beers, ciders, and natural wines, but we tend to drop by for the whiskies.
To celebrate World Whisky Day, the team members at Earl’s will be offering up their own unique version of the Penicillin cocktail, a modern Scotch Whisky classic, which they’ll be making with one of Benriach’s more smoky expressions, mixed with a hearty serving of lemon and ginger. Fortunately for all of us, this particular cocktail is too delicious to limit to just one day, so it will be available for the entirety of May.
Fortunate Son, Sydney, NSW
Just across the road from the iconic Enmore Theatre, Fortunate Son is the perfect place to hang with friends before or after a gig, offering up an impressive selection of spirits and cocktails.
Having been voted Australia’s best bar in 2022 at the Bartender Magazine Bar Awards, you’ll be hard-pressed to find a better place to celebrate World Whisky Day. This is particularly true as the Fortunate Son crew will be offering up an impossible-to-resist Tangled Up In You cocktail, which combines GlenDronach 12yo, Cynar, Orange Bitters, Angostura Bitters, and lemon zest to create a rich and complex yet somehow refreshingly simple Scotch experience. Whisky & Alement, Melbourne, Vic
Another award-winning venue, Whisky & Alement was voted Best Whisky Bar at the World Whiskies Awards 2023, so it’s no exaggeration to describe this incredible establishment as world-class. Offering hundreds of whiskies, a wide range of cocktails and a rotating list of local and international craft beers, you’ll always find something to suit your mood at this Melbourne institution.
In celebration of World Whisky Day, the team at Whisky & Alement will be running a version of the classic Penicillin cocktail using Benriach whisky for the entirety of May, so be sure to stop by. The Den (at The Atlantic), Melbourne, Vic
Come for the comfort of the velvet sofas and vintage Persian rugs, stay for the whisky deliciousness. Located beneath The Atlantic right by the Yarra River, The Den boasts a distinct nocturnal ambiance that’s further enhanced by beverages served up by some of Melbourne’s top mixologists and excellent live music.
Championing all things whisky for the entirety of May, the team at The Den will be serving up whisky flights all month, featuring irresistible expressions from both GlenDronach and Benriach.
Strato, Melbourne, Vic
With its seven-metre-tall glass windows and adjoining alfresco terrace providing an unparalleled 360-degree view of Melbourne, Port Phillip Bay and beyond, you’ll be hard pressed to find a venue that more effectively elevates your World Whisky Day celebrations.
The Strato team will be serving delicious GlenDronach whisky flights for the remainder of May in recognition of World Whisky Day – featuring GlenDronach 12yo, Portwood and Traditionally Peated as a three-dram flight – and afterwards why not dive into Strato’s impressive range of vintage GlenDronach whiskies, including an impressive back catalogue of Grandeur releases?
The Baxter Inn, Sydney, NSW
If you’re looking to spend World Whisky Day in the company of some of Sydney’s most knowledgeable whisky devotees, you can’t go past The Baxter Inn. Not only does this venue offer up a wider variety of whisky bottles than you can shake a Spey Glass at, but the team knows the story behind each one too. Just ask.
For World Whisky Day (and the entirety of May) the Baxter team will be serving up the Burnside Highball. This delightful cocktail consists of a delicious combination of Benriach 12yo, hickory smoked honey, and cardamom, all lengthened with soda.
